Walrus: Decentralized Storage That Actually Makes Sense (For Once!)

What's up crypto fam!
Let's talk about something everybody needs but nobody wants to think about: data storage. I know, I know – not as sexy as 100x moonshots or DeFi yields. But stick with me, because decentralized storage is about to become WAY more important than you think.
The Cloud Storage Reality Check
Right now, your photos, documents, and that embarrassing video from 2015 are probably living on: Amazon Web Services (AWS), Google Cloud, Microsoft Azure or some other centralized giant
These companies are basically the landlords of the internet. They control: What you can store, How much it costs, Whether your data stays accessible - Oh and they can read everything!
It's like renting an apartment where the landlord has keys to every room and can raise rent whenever they feel like it. Not ideal, right?
Enter Walrus: The Decentralized Storage Hero
@Walrus 🦭/acc is building decentralized storage infrastructure that doesn't require you to trust a single company with your data. Think of it as Airbnb for data storage – instead of one landlord, you have a network of hosts, and no single one can kick you out or snoop through your stuff.
Here's the magic:
- Your data gets split into pieces (sharding)
- Each piece is stored across multiple nodes
- It's encrypted, so nobody can read your stuff
- The network ensures redundancy (your data won't disappear)
It's like taking a jigsaw puzzle, splitting it up, and hiding the pieces with different friends. Even if one friend loses their piece, you can still complete the puzzle. And nobody can see the full picture unless they have access to all pieces.

Why Should DeFi Enthusiasts Care?
Great question! Here's where it gets interesting:
• NFT Storage: Remember when NFTs were all the rage? Well, many NFT images were stored on centralized servers. Some disappeared when companies shut down. Walrus provides permanent, decentralized storage for NFT metadata. Your jpeg of a monkey is safe forever.
• DeFi Data: DeFi protocols need to store data – transaction histories, oracle data, protocol parameters. Storing this on-chain is expensive. Walrus offers a cheaper, decentralized alternative.
• Web3 Applications: Want to build a truly decentralized app? You need decentralized storage. Otherwise, you're just building a regular app with a blockchain bolt-on. Walrus completes the decentralization stack.
• DAO Documents: Where should DAOs store their proposals, voting records, and governance documents? Centralized cloud? Nah. Walrus provides censorship-resistant storage for DAO operations.
The Tech Behind the Tusks (Because Walruses Have Tusks, Get It?)
• Erasure Coding: Fancy term for "we split your data cleverly so you only need a fraction of pieces to reconstruct it." It's more efficient than just copying everything multiple times.
• Redundancy Without Waste: Traditional cloud storage = multiple full copies. Walrus = smart splitting. You get security without paying for 10x the storage.
• Incentivized Network: Storage providers earn tokens for hosting data. Users pay tokens for storage. It's a marketplace, baby! Free market forces keep prices competitive.

Real Talk: The Challenges
Let's keep it real – decentralized storage faces a few hurdles:
• Speed: Centralized clouds are FAST. Decentralized networks are getting there but aren't as snappy yet.
• User Experience: Most people don't want to think about storage. They want it to "just work." Walrus needs to make this seamless.
• Cost Competitiveness: AWS has economies of scale. Decentralized networks need to prove they can compete on price.
But technology improves, and these challenges are being tackled. Early internet was slow too – now look at us streaming 4K videos while doing backflips. (Okay, maybe just the streaming part.)
